The Initial Buzz: Why Fekir to Liverpool Seemed Inevitable

Back in 2018, Nabil Fekir Liverpool chatter was everywhere. Liverpool was fresh off a Champions League final appearance, and Jurgen Klopp was looking to add more firepower and creativity to his attacking options. Fekir, who was the captain and talisman of Lyon, had just enjoyed a fantastic season, scoring 23 goals and providing eight assists in all competitions. His ability to play as an attacking midfielder or a second striker made him an ideal fit for Klopp's high-pressing, dynamic system. The media was all over it, with reports suggesting that personal terms had been agreed upon and that Fekir was eager to make the move to Anfield. There were even pictures of Fekir in a Liverpool kit! The Medical That Changed Everything

So, where did it all go wrong with the Nabil Fekir Liverpool deal? The infamous medical is the main culprit. Fekir underwent a medical examination at Liverpool, and this is where the problems began to surface. Reports emerged that Liverpool's medical team had concerns about a previous knee injury that Fekir had sustained earlier in his career. Specifically, there were fears that the injury could potentially lead to long-term issues and affect his performance and availability. This is where things got really complicated. Liverpool reportedly sought to renegotiate the terms of the deal, seeking a lower transfer fee to reflect the perceived risk associated with Fekir's knee. Lyon, however, were unwilling to accept a reduced offer, and negotiations stalled. The situation became increasingly tense, with both clubs digging their heels in. The back-and-forth between Liverpool and Lyon created a cloud of uncertainty around the transfer. Fans were left in the dark, unsure of what to believe. Was the deal off? Was there still a chance it could be salvaged? The medical examination became a major sticking point, and ultimately, it proved to be the undoing of the transfer. The Aftermath: What Happened After the Transfer Collapsed?

The collapse of the Nabil Fekir Liverpool transfer had significant repercussions for all parties involved. For Nabil Fekir, it was a huge blow. He had his heart set on a move to Liverpool, and to see it fall apart at the last minute must have been devastating. He remained at Lyon for another season before eventually joining Real Betis in 2019. While he has continued to showcase his talent, there's always been a sense of "what if" surrounding his career. What if he had joined Liverpool? How different would his career have been? For Liverpool, missing out on Fekir forced them to look at alternative options. While they didn't immediately sign a direct replacement, they continued to strengthen their squad, eventually adding players like Thiago Alcantara and Diogo Jota, who have added quality and depth to their midfield and attack. Fekir Now: What's He Up to These Days?

So, what's Nabil Fekir up to now? After his failed move to Liverpool, Fekir spent one more season with Lyon before eventually joining Real Betis in La Liga in 2019. He's been a key player for the Spanish side, showcasing his talent and creativity in the heart of their midfield. While he may not have reached the heights that many expected of him, he's still a valuable asset to his team and a popular figure among the fans. At Real Betis, Fekir has continued to display his technical skills, vision, and ability to score goals. He's also become known for his leadership qualities, often captaining the team and leading by example.
